10 things you don’t know about the Chief Blonde, Shelley Zurek

February 5, 2015 By Shelley Zurek 62 Comments

You thought you knew me but…10 things you don’t know

The Chief Blonde, Shelley Zurek, Still Blonde after all these YEARS

1. In high school, I played the bassoon…really poorly

I switched from the flute to the bassoon because I was last chair flute and I don’t do “Last Chair” very well. Plus, as a bassoonist, I got to sit in the second row with the brass players (ie. guys) which was A LOT better than sitting in front row with a bunch of girls who could were WAAAAAY better than me.

2.  Julia Child is my hero

Okay, this might not be a huge secret, given that I have wrote about her here, here and here. She is “More Tigger, and Less Eyore” and I love that about a person.

3.  I wear size 8.5 shoes

4.  My hair was is really blonde

The CHief Blonde Shelley Zurek Still blonde after all these YEARS

My hair was blonde in my childhood and has always been blonde throughout my life. I can’t see me ever not being blonde…gray only exists on the walls of my home (see #5 below)

5. My favorite paint color is Sherwin William Zurich White

10 things you don't know

 

Why do I love this Sherwin Williams Zurich white? Several reason actually.

First, I love gray. LOVE IT! Even though it’s falls in Sherwin Williams White family, it is actually a lovely light gray. I goes with every color under the sun.

Second, I have lived in Zurich Switzerland for 4.5 years when my kids were young. It seemed a natural color to choose. Plus, I am of Swiss heritage, as well. SO it’s really a ancestral thing…sort-of. My kitchen, pantry, bathroom, bonus room, and half of the basement are painted this color.

My last name is Zurek, pronounced just like Zurich…so duh.

6.  When I was a tween, I raced in the Soap Box Derby

soap box derby

That’s me on the left modeling those snappy cupcake glasses that were so popular at the time! The EEK feeling you are experiencing right now, is EXACTLY how you will feel when you look at your photos in ten years and see yourself in those hipster glasses. Just so you know.

7.  One of my bucket list items: Experience every kind of transportation

Chicago Double decker bus

For example, I have been on an elephant, donkey, horse, carriage, train, small plane, jet, ship, boat, row boat, pontoon, hover craft, hot air balloon, bike, motorcycle, mini-bike, car, dump truck, semi-truck, earth mover, tractor, mail truck, back hoe, bulldozer, bicycle, tricycle, stilts, cog wheel train, train, street car, bus, trolley, double decker bus, cable car, snow mobile, 4 wheeler, soap box derby, ski lift, skis, roller coaster, people mover, moving sidewalk, elevator, escalator, sled, toboggan, saucer, and probably oodles more that I can’t recall. I have yet to ride on a fire truck, camel, race car, rickshaw, helicopter, sleigh, or a Segway. How about you? What did I miss?

8.  Growing up, I wanted to be a librarian

But hey, now I am a super model so… (see all my outfits)

9.  I have an MBA from the University of Chicago

Wow, all this AND blonde hair…

10.  I used to work in Industry

In the past, I have worked for GM (Production, Marketing and Labor Relations) and with Seco Tools (Industrial PR consulting). I believe that US Manufacturing is the engine that makes our country great. I think this video from GE explains the value of industry to the world.
